About the role
- Deliver exceptional support experiences for our customers through advanced security expertise and thoughtful, empathetic communication
- Serve as a technical leader and mentor, helping guide other team members through positive influence and knowledge sharing
- Work closely with our customers to provide expert-level advisory services on complex security questions and product issues
- Lead troubleshooting efforts with customers and perform advanced log analysis to provide comprehensive context around security incidents
- Be on-call for rare critical security incidents and help lead response efforts
- Actively contribute to incident responses and help propose technical solutions
- Share your deep technical expertise across all levels of the Security Operations team, our customers, and colleagues throughout the organization
- Work closely with the Incident Detection Engineering team to triage critical and high priority security incidents
- Provide leadership and mentorship during security events
- Drive Security Operations team efficiency through process creation, optimization, and innovative feature ideas
- Work on special projects and initiatives to expand team skillsets and capabilities
- Regularly contribute to team content creation including how-to articles, documentation, and blogs
- Serve as a sought-after resource among team members for complex technical challenges
- Actively advocate for customers throughout the organization
Requirements
- 5+ years of experience working in cybersecurity roles with progressive responsibility
- Demonstrated advanced expertise in cybersecurity with steadfast curiosity for learning new attack vectors, threats, and security frameworks
- Strong proficiency in Windows endpoint security and vulnerability management
- Comprehensive knowledge of industry-adopted frameworks and methodologies (MITRE ATT&CK, CIS, NIST, ISO, PCI-DSS, etc.)
- Extensive experience with SIEM platforms and SOC operations
- Strong grasp of SQL with ability to write complex queries
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ills with ability to communicate effectively across all departments
- Experience with Zendesk or similar support ticketing software
- Deep understanding of how nearly all aspects of security applications work
- Ability to handle customer-reported issues with minimal guidance from peers
- Ability to work at a fast pace while maintaining high quality, analyzing complex information and responding to customers in a timely manner
- Strong big-picture thinking, understanding how every customer interaction impacts their broader experience
- Ability to work independently and lead initiatives with minimal direction
- Leadership qualities including mentoring capabilities and positive team influence
- Consistently meets or exceeds KPIs and responds to tickets well above SLA guarantees
- Proficiency with productivity tools (Google Workspace, Zoom, Slack) and ability to master specialized software platforms
- Experience with Regex, GCP, AWS, and/or Kibana (preferred)
- Mastery of BigQuery and/or advanced analytics platforms (preferred)
- Education in IT/Computer Science or Cybersecurity (preferred)
- Industry certifications (CISSP, GCIH, GCFA, or similar advanced certifications preferred)
- Experience with process improvement and team leadership (preferred)
- Track record of contributing to technical content and knowledge sharing (preferred)
